Apologies for butting in but presume you're talking cPanel WebMail (Horde etc), then port 2096 is for secure access so you would need https://mydomain.tld:2096 (Alternatively http://mydomain.tld:2095).
At the login prompt, enter the full email address user@mydomain.tld or user+mydomain.tld along with the correct password. Works for me ...Gadge

You can access the webmail login directly by going to http://mydomain.com/webmail and entering the username - which is the email address - and the password
